Explain that this is a screening interview and as such, will be short and take 510 minutes. Explain that at the end of this, the hotel will be getting in touch with all candidates over the next 3 weeks either by telephone or letter. d. Briefly introduce the Hotel and give the candidate information about the hotel and the pany, the job related roles and responsibilities, working conditions, benefits and opportunities for advancement. See attached Fact Sheet. e. Be Professional at all times. For consistency, use the attached “Screening Form” during the WalkIn Interview. Do not stray and ask any discriminatory or non job related questions. f. If you do not speak the home language and are having trouble municating, ask for assistance in translation. g. End the meeting on a warm note advising the candidate that the hotel will be in contact with every candidate over the ing period either by letter or through telephone. Do not offer, promise a position to any candidate. State “Thank you for your time today. As you can see we have had many applicants apply with us and we now need to shortlist, then there will be other rounds of interviewing, reference checks and health checks to conduct. It sounds like a lengthy process but we will make it as short as possible. You will hear from the hotel either through telephone or letter over the next two – three weeks. Thank you again for your time today”. If you are asked “how did I do?”. Simply reply “I’m sure you did well however as I have mentioned we have had many candidates to shortlist and we must first go through all the steps first. Thankyou for your time and you will hear from us soon.” h. Ensure sufficient “Reserved” candidates are kept for further review.
